Meaning & History

Ralina is a female given name of Tatar origin whose exact meaning is unknown. It may be a modern variant or diminutive of names ending in <-ali> or a creative coinage within Tatar naming traditions. Despite the lack of a clear etymology, the name has gained modest usage among Tatars and neighboring Turkic peoples. The suffix <-ina> is common in feminized forms, potentially aligning it with Tatar family names or elaborate feminine forms typical of the region.

In the broader context of Tatar onomastics, many modern names draw from Arabic, Persian, or Turkic roots due to the influence of Islam and cultural exchanges. Ralina might be a feminized version of a masculine name like Ralin or Ralif, which occasionally appear in Tatar communities. Enriched from Islamic cultural heritage, Tatar names often combine roots meaning 'something related to,' but since the literal meaning is obscure, Ralina remains a favorite likely chosen for its melodic cadence rather than any preserved definition.

The name distribution shows concentration in Tatarstan, though limited comparative data exists. Ralina is considered rare even within that republic.
